Transaction 81542920d446164a8020895947c96c04125ccc12b335ffb5d09ad9e79985503a
2 Input
2 Outputs
- 81542920d446164a8020895947c96c04125ccc12b335ffb5d09ad9e79985503a:0
- 81542920d446164a8020895947c96c04125ccc12b335ffb5d09ad9e79985503a:1
value 1671096
address 1C9DXbAF6ZRh6TgCTRCZvX3xm8SSHr1imc
value 8884058
address 1MCTz9kzxTMZe1mxm8GwH6nr9vYbGN3eb5